Output cad579e0529a81abb4aca39f83b8608dadc180ef1e8da7ae2e7eb04326d1e81f:12

value
1581000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ea92b99d650e1e1512fbf302a49a4aa406c9692a OP_EQUAL
address
3P5Kp4tPya3eqAcQg4cqpmXQGzZyHL64RK
transaction
cad579e0529a81abb4aca39f83b8608dadc180ef1e8da7ae2e7eb04326d1e81f
spent
true